Output 26685f0925fc4e2512b15d1cd54ffec88c1184aaa05a07704f2b7c185757c0f3:1

value
33175610
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53e1ac6361ad9dab7982fc7edb5fba5aab31bc95 OP_EQUALVERIFY OP_CHECKSIG
address
18eXRz5MPeTVFeeby9pg7kgedwuVuTNjUD
transaction
26685f0925fc4e2512b15d1cd54ffec88c1184aaa05a07704f2b7c185757c0f3
spent
true